Transaction 17f70ec83c91346a3e29a7dcb397ad79226cf557e4c7b45d8228635bb48cc763

1 Input
2 Outputs
  • 17f70ec83c91346a3e29a7dcb397ad79226cf557e4c7b45d8228635bb48cc763:0
  • value  902000
    address  17taJsKc3wWauwdnmy8CEeztSxsG1Aorqf
  • 17f70ec83c91346a3e29a7dcb397ad79226cf557e4c7b45d8228635bb48cc763:1
  • value  11807402686
    address  3ERMwBuszc13tct1zz2su2oRQbwtqQPZCK